| Sercotel Posada del Lucero - Almirante Apodaca 7, Seville, Sevilla, 41003 |
| |
Inaugurated in March 2006, this charming new 4-star hotel boasts luxurious, high quality, contemporary accommodation harmoniously integrated into a sympathetically renovated and carefully restored 17th century building. The hotel's attractive original building is classified as a cultural heritage site. The structure and many of the beautiful original features have been sensitively preserved and painstakingly restored. The building now houses stylish modern accommodation, fully equipped with contemporary comforts and facilities, which surround the hotel's attractive original courtyard with its arches, columns and wooden beams. Historically, the building was once an Alhondigas, a public granary and inn where merchants and traders would stay. Today, the hotel offers luxurious 4-star accommodation in the heart of Seville, in an original and unique atmosphere which evokes the elegance and sophistication of a bygone age, with peace and tranquillity to match. |

| Boutique Hotel Holos - Uruguay, Seville, Sevilla, 41012 |
| |
Situated in a quiet area of Seville, this sleek and contemporary hotel is intimate with just 7 rooms and ideal for those looking for something architecturally enticing and unique. A short drive from the main tourist centre of the city, the Heliopolis district of Seville is an attractive haven away from the bustling city centre. Built originally in 1929 for the Ibero-America exhibition, it is one of the most colourful and delightful areas of the city given its Andalusi style houses, leafy gardens and majestic air. The hotel is an innovative space that maximises daylight and has an avant-garde terrace and Zen garden with wooden decking, flowerbeds and a backdrop of white walls, providing a peaceful sanctuary after a long day. The interior is also a pleasant space with smooth lines and light wooden floors. The furnishings are also ultra-modern and the accommodation is light and airy. |
